Description
This is an early 19th-century stable block associated with Bitchfield House. It is constructed of ashlar with a hipped slate roof and includes a single yellow brick wall stack. The single-storey building has a plinth and a four-bay front with a facetted angle to the road. The front features two planked doors, each with an overlight, and two plain fixed windows, all with segmental heads.
